1. Rome – Palerme: Calme – Assez animé – Rome
2. Tunis – Nefta: Modéré, très rythmé
3. Valencia: Animé – Modéré – Mouvement du début

The first movement, `Rome-Palermo`, evokes the sights and sounds of these major Italian centers with a tune that matches the regional flair.
Tunis-Nefta brings sailors ashore in North Africa; timpani and pulsating strings create a hypnotic rhythm, while the oboe imitates the chromatic improvisations of local reed instruments.
`Valencia`, a seething dance scene, completes the suite with a vivid depiction of Spanish culture.
